FORT and NVIDIA Deploy Outside-In Robot Safety System

3 Key Points

  1. What happened

    FORT Robotics joined NVIDIA's Halos for Robotics ecosystem and introduced an "Outside-In Safety" solution that uses external infrastructure sensors and visual AI agents to control robot behavior in real time. The system combines NVIDIA's Outside-In Safety Blueprint with FORT's Trust Layer and will be demonstrated this week at the Automate conference in Chicago, with a joint presentation at the Humanoid Robotics Pavilion on June 23rd.

  2. Why it matters

    Traditional robot safety systems rely only on onboard sensors and operate conservatively, which slows down productivity. This system automatically adjusts robot speed based on what external cameras see, allowing robots to work at higher efficiency while staying safe around workers. This means warehouses and manufacturers can reuse existing building-mounted cameras to get faster inventory and truck operations without sacrificing safety.

  3. What to watch

    The system uses NVIDIA IGX Thor and NVIDIA Holoscan Sensor Bridge for computing power and sensor connectivity. FORT is accredited through NVIDIA's Halos AI Systems Inspection Lab (an ANSI National Accreditation Board-accredited lab) to verify functional safety, cybersecurity, and AI compliance for autonomous systems at industrial scale.
